Ceremonial Gift-Giving Activity of the Province of Misamis Oriental at MOPH–Initao

The Province of Misamis Oriental, headed by Hon. Governor Juliette T. Uy, successfully officiated a Gift-Giving Activity today for the admitted patients of MOPH–Initao, which served as the host venue for the event.

Gift packs containing 2 kilos of rice, canned goods such as sardines and beef loaf, and basic hygiene items including bath soaps, toothpaste, toothbrush, shampoos, and bath towels were distributed to our admitted patients and their watcher representatives.

After the ceremonial gift-giving, the guests proceeded with ward hopping, visiting patients who are confined, and continued to the Emergency Room to personally extend the same gesture of care and support. Thereafter, the delegation exited the hospital to proceed to the Provincial Jail, where a similar gift-giving activity was also conducted.

This meaningful initiative reflects the Province’s commitment to compassion, service, and reaching out to those in need especialy this holiday season.

✨ Successful Buntis Class Today ✨

We are truly grateful for the successful conduct of our Buntis Class today, with a total attendance of 14 pregnant mothers, filled with learning, sharing, and joyful moments 💕

The activity flowed smoothly with the following sequence:

1️⃣ Ma’am Miraluna Ramos, RM, RN, MN - Chief Nurse opened the program with her introduction and led the discussion proper, setting a warm and engaging tone for the session.
2️⃣ This was followed by Ma’am Loma Tacbobo, RM, had read and discussed an informative and meaningful lesson on Breastfeeding, emphasizing its importance for both mother and baby.
3️⃣ Ma’am Christine Faith Turtola Pio, Hospital Dietician and Nutritionist then discussed Proper Nutrition and Diet among Pregnant Women, providing practical and helpful guidance. With her generosity, she also gave special prizes to the attendees such as the early birds,.

A trivia quiz (question and answer portion) was conducted for the pregnant mothers. Participants happily received small but meaningful gifts such as playmats, cooking gloves, biscuit packs, kitchenware holders, and envelopes with cash.

Thank you to all our speakers and participants for making this Buntis Class very educational, engaging, and truly memorable. We look forward to more activities that support and empower our mothers-to-be.

SUCCESSFUL BLOOD LETTING ACTIVITY 🩸

Today, December 18, 2025, another successful Blood Letting Activity was conducted at the Ambulance Area of MOPH–Initao through the strong coordination and support of our Chief of Hospital -Dr. Iris B. Ratunil, RN, MD, MPSM, Chief Nurse- Ma'am Miraluna N. Ramos, RN, RM, MN All the department heads, and our dedicated Laboratory Personnel headed by Ma'am Betsy Rose. Sacabin.RMT.

We would also like to express our sincere appreciation to our partner/personnel from the Department of Health (DOH) – Cagayan de Oro City, for their hands on blood letting professional skills in this time of life-saving endeavor.

We extend our heartfelt thanks to our Coordinating Committee for their cooperation and genuine support: For the food preparation headed by Sir Michel Balingit and company. Every donor received 3 kilos of rice as a token of appreciation. In addition, all blood donors were served nutritious beef soup, eggs and rice to ensure they received the proper nutritional support and recovery after donation.

Thank you to the 34 persons in total who came and donated blood. Your generosity and compassion truly help save lives. ❤️
